#1fb9c9 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1fb9c9 is composed of 12.2% red, 72.5% green and 78.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 84.6% cyan, 8% magenta, 0% yellow and 21.2% black. It has a hue angle of 185.6 degrees, a saturation of 73.3% and a lightness of 45.5%. #1fb9c9 color hex could be obtained by blending #3effff with #007393. Closest websafe color is: #33cccc.

● #1fb9c9 color description : Strong cyan.
#1fb9c9 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1fb9c9 has RGB values of R:31, G:185, B:201 and CMYK values of C:0.85, M:0.08, Y:0, K:0.21. Its decimal value is 2079177.

Shades and Tints of #1fb9c9
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020d0e is the darkest color, while #fcfe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#1fb9c9
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6f7879 is the less saturated color, while #04cfe4 is the most saturated one.
